internal static void GatherSDKsFromRegistryImpl()

in src/Utilities/ToolLocationHelper.cs [2706:2890]


        internal static void GatherSDKsFromRegistryImpl(Dictionary<TargetPlatformSDK, TargetPlatformSDK> platformMonikers, string registryKeyRoot, RegistryView registryView, RegistryHive registryHive, GetRegistrySubKeyNames getRegistrySubKeyNames, GetRegistrySubKeyDefaultValue getRegistrySubKeyDefaultValue, OpenBaseKey openBaseKey, FileExists fileExists)
        {
            ErrorUtilities.VerifyThrowArgumentNull(platformMonikers, "PlatformMonikers");
            if (String.IsNullOrEmpty(registryKeyRoot))
            {
                return;
            }

            // Open the hive for a given view
            using (RegistryKey baseKey = openBaseKey(registryHive, registryView))
            {
                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"Gathering SDKS from registryRoot '{0}', Hive '{1}', View '{2}'", registryKeyRoot, registryHive, registryView);

                // Attach the target platform to the registry root. This should give us something like 
                // SOFTWARE\MICROSOFT\Microsoft SDKs\Windows

                // Get all of the platform identifiers
                IEnumerable<string> platformIdentifiers = getRegistrySubKeyNames(baseKey, registryKeyRoot);

                // No identifiers found.
                if (platformIdentifiers == null)
                {
                    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"No sub keys found under registryKeyRoot {0}", registryKeyRoot);
                    return;
                }

                foreach (string platformIdentifier in platformIdentifiers)
                {
                    string platformIdentifierKey = registryKeyRoot + @"\" + platformIdentifier;

                    // Get all of the version folders under the targetplatform identifier key
                    IEnumerable<string> versions = getRegistrySubKeyNames(baseKey, platformIdentifierKey);

                    // No versions found.
                    if (versions == null)
                    {
                        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"No sub keys found under platformIdentifierKey {0}", platformIdentifierKey);
                        return;
                    }

                    // Returns a a sorted set of versions and their associated registry strings. The reason we need the original strings is that
                    // they may contain a v where as a version does not support a v.
                    SortedDictionary<Version, List<string>> sortedVersions = VersionUtilities.GatherVersionStrings(null, versions);

                    foreach (KeyValuePair<Version, List<string>> registryVersions in sortedVersions)
                    {
                        TargetPlatformSDK platformSDKKey = new TargetPlatformSDK(platformIdentifier, registryVersions.Key, null);
                        TargetPlatformSDK targetPlatformSDK = null;

                        // Go through each of the raw version strings which were found in the registry
                        foreach (string version in registryVersions.Value)
                        {
                            // Attach the version and extensionSDKs strings to the platformIdentifier key we built up above.
                            // Make something like SOFTWARE\MICROSOFT\Microsoft SDKs\Windows\8.0\
                            string platformSDKsRegistryKey = platformIdentifierKey + @"\" + version;

                            string platformSDKDirectory = getRegistrySubKeyDefaultValue(baseKey, platformSDKsRegistryKey);

                            // May be null because some use installationfolder instead
                            if (platformSDKDirectory == null)
                            {
                                using (RegistryKey versionKey = baseKey.OpenSubKey(platformSDKsRegistryKey))
                                {
                                    if (versionKey != null)
                                    {
                                        platformSDKDirectory = versionKey.GetValue("InstallationFolder") as string;
                                    }
                                }
                            }

                            bool platformSDKmanifestExists = false;

                            if (platformSDKDirectory != null)
                            {
                                string platformSDKManifest = Path.Combine(platformSDKDirectory, "SDKManifest.xml");
                                // Windows kits is special because they do not have an sdk manifest yet, this is for the windows sdk. We will accept them as they are. For others
                                // we will require that an sdkmanifest exists.
                                platformSDKmanifestExists = fileExists(platformSDKManifest) || platformSDKDirectory.IndexOf("Windows Kits", StringComparison.OrdinalIgnoreCase) >= 0;
                            }

                            if (targetPlatformSDK == null && !platformMonikers.TryGetValue(platformSDKKey, out targetPlatformSDK))
                            {
                                targetPlatformSDK = new TargetPlatformSDK(platformSDKKey.TargetPlatformIdentifier, platformSDKKey.TargetPlatformVersion, platformSDKmanifestExists ? platformSDKDirectory : null);
                                platformMonikers.Add(targetPlatformSDK, targetPlatformSDK);
                            }

                            if (targetPlatformSDK.Path == null && platformSDKmanifestExists)
                            {
                                targetPlatformSDK.Path = platformSDKDirectory;
                            }

                            // Gather the set of platforms supported by this SDK if it's a valid one. 
                            if (!String.IsNullOrEmpty(targetPlatformSDK.Path))
                            {
                                GatherPlatformsForSdk(targetPlatformSDK);
                            }

                            // Make something like SOFTWARE\MICROSOFT\Microsoft SDKs\Windows\8.0\ExtensionSdks
                            string extensionSDKsKey = platformSDKsRegistryKey + @"\ExtensionSDKs";
                            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"Getting subkeys of '{0}'", extensionSDKsKey);

                            // Get all of the SDK name folders under the ExtensionSDKs registry key
                            IEnumerable<string> sdkNames = getRegistrySubKeyNames(baseKey, extensionSDKsKey);
                            if (sdkNames == null)
                            {
                                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"Could not find subkeys of '{0}'", extensionSDKsKey);
                                continue;
                            }

                            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"Found subkeys of '{0}'", extensionSDKsKey);

                            // For each SDK folder under ExtensionSDKs
                            foreach (string sdkName in sdkNames)
                            {
                                // Combine the SDK Name with the ExtensionSDKs key we have built up above.
                                // Make something like SOFTWARE\MICROSOFT\Windows SDKs\Windows\8.0\ExtensionSDKs\XNA
                                string sdkNameKey = extensionSDKsKey + @"\" + sdkName;

                                //Get all of the version registry keys under the SDK Name Key.
                                IEnumerable<string> sdkVersions = getRegistrySubKeyNames(baseKey, sdkNameKey);

                                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"Getting subkeys of '{0}'", sdkNameKey);
                                if (sdkVersions == null)
                                {
                                    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"Could not find subkeys of '{0}'", sdkNameKey);
                                    continue;
                                }

                                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"Found subkeys of '{0}'", sdkNameKey);

                                // For each version registry entry under the SDK Name registry key
                                foreach (string sdkVersion in sdkVersions)
                                {
                                    // We only want registry keys which parse directly to versions
                                    Version tempVersion;
                                    if (Version.TryParse(sdkVersion, out tempVersion))
                                    {
                                        string sdkDirectoryKey = sdkNameKey + @"\" + sdkVersion;
                                        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"Getting default key for '{0}'", sdkDirectoryKey);

                                        // Now that we found the registry key we need to get its default value which points to the directory this SDK is in.
                                        string directoryName = getRegistrySubKeyDefaultValue(baseKey, sdkDirectoryKey);
                                        string sdkKey = TargetPlatformSDK.GetSdkKey(sdkName, sdkVersion);
                                        if (directoryName != null)
                                        {
                                            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"SDK installation location = '{0}'", directoryName);

                                            // Make sure the directory exists and that it has not been added before.
                                            if (!targetPlatformSDK.ExtensionSDKs.ContainsKey(sdkKey))
                                            {
                                                if (FileUtilities.DirectoryExistsNoThrow(directoryName))
                                                {
                                                    string sdkManifestFileLocation = Path.Combine(directoryName, "SDKManifest.xml");
                                                    if (fileExists(sdkManifestFileLocation))
                                                    {
                                                        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"Adding SDK '{0}'  at '{1}' to the list of found sdks.", sdkKey, directoryName);
                                                        targetPlatformSDK.ExtensionSDKs.Add(sdkKey, FileUtilities.EnsureTrailingSlash(directoryName));
                                                    }
                                                    else
                                                    {
                                                        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"No SDKManifest.xml file found at '{0}'.", sdkManifestFileLocation);
                                                    }
                                                }
                                                else
                                                {
                                                    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"SDK directory '{0}' does not exist", directoryName);
                                                }
                                            }
                                            else
                                            {
                                                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"SDK key was previously added. '{0}'", sdkKey);
                                            }
                                        }
                                        else
                                        {
                                            ErrorUtilities.DebugTraceMessage("GatherSDKsFromRegistryImpl", "Default key is null for '{0}'", sdkDirectoryKey);
                                        }
                                    }
                                }
                            }
                        }
                    }
                }
            }
        }
